Delicate Quote by Deb Caletti
““Love was such a delicate thing, requiring tissue-paper touch and the safest place, yet there it was out in the real world, where it got battered by storms of ill will and bad circumstances and demons of your own or of other people. Love didn’t stand a chance.””
About This Quote
Source Novel: The Art of Falling Apart, 2021
Love is fragile, easily damaged by negativity and hardship, making it vulnerable in reality.
In simple terms: Love is delicate and can be hurt by harsh conditions.
